1N4099-1 thru 1N4135-1 &
1N4614-1 thru 1N4627-1
Low Noise Zener Diode Series
Rev. V6
Features
Available in JAN, JANTX, JANTXV and JANS per
MIL-PRF-19500/435
Tight tolerances available in plus or minus 2% or
1% with C or D suffix respectively.
500 mW power handling
Hermetically sealed axial-leaded glass DO-35
package.
Also available in DO-213 MELF style package.
